#[cfg(feature = "completion")]
use std::collections::HashMap;
#[cfg(feature = "completion")]
use html_languageservice::{
CompletionConfiguration, DefaultDocumentContext, HTMLDataManager, HTMLLanguageService,
HTMLLanguageServiceOptions, Quotes,
};
#[cfg(feature = "completion")]
use lsp_textdocument::FullTextDocument;
#[cfg(feature = "completion")]
use lsp_types::*;
#[cfg(feature = "completion")]
fn test_completion_for(
value: &str,
expected: Expected,
settings: Option<CompletionConfiguration>,
ls_options: Option<HTMLLanguageServiceOptions>,
) {
let offset = value.find('|').unwrap();
let value: &str = &format!("{}{}", &value[..offset], &value[offset + 1..]);
let ls_options = if let Some(ls_options) = ls_options {
ls_options
} else {
HTMLLanguageServiceOptions::default()
};
let ls = HTMLLanguageService::new(&ls_options);
let document = FullTextDocument::new("html".to_string(), 0, value.to_string());
let position = document.position_at(offset as u32);
let data_manager = ls.create_data_manager(true, None);
let html_document = ls.parse_html_document(&document, &data_manager);
let list = ls.do_complete(
&document,
&position,
&html_document,
&DefaultDocumentContext,
settings.as_ref(),
&HTMLDataManager::default(),
);
let mut labels: Vec<String> = list.items.iter().map(|i| i.label.clone()).collect();
labels.sort();
let mut previous = None;
for label in &labels {
assert!(
previous != Some(label),
"Duplicate label {} in {}",
label,
labels.join(",")
);
previous = Some(label);
}
if expected.count.is_some() {
assert_eq!(list.items.len(), expected.count.unwrap());
}
if expected.items.len() > 0 {
for item in &expected.items {
assert_completion(&list, item, &document);
}
}
}

#[cfg(feature = "completion")]
#[test]
fn do_quote_complete() {
test_quote_completion("<a foo=|", Some(r#""$1""#.to_string()), None);
test_quote_completion(
"<a foo=|",
Some("'$1'".to_string()),
Some(&CompletionConfiguration {
attribute_default_value: Quotes::Single,
hide_auto_complete_proposals: false,
provider: HashMap::new(),
}),
);
test_quote_completion(
"<a foo=|",
None,
Some(&CompletionConfiguration {
attribute_default_value: Quotes::None,
hide_auto_complete_proposals: false,
provider: HashMap::new(),
}),
);
test_quote_completion("<a foo=|=", None, None);
test_quote_completion(r#"<a foo=|"bar""#, None, None);
test_quote_completion("<a foo=|></a>", Some(r#""$1""#.to_string()), None);
test_quote_completion(r#"<a foo="bar=|""#, None, None);
test_quote_completion(r#"<a baz=| foo="bar">"#, Some(r#""$1""#.to_string()), None);
test_quote_completion("<a>< foo=| /a>", None, None);
test_quote_completion("<a></ foo=| a>", None, None);
test_quote_completion(
r#"<a foo="bar" \n baz=| ></a>"#,
Some(r#""$1""#.to_string()),
None,
);
}
#[cfg(feature = "completion")]
#[test]
fn do_tag_complete() {
test_tag_completion("<div>|", Some("$0</div>".to_string()));
test_tag_completion("<div>|</div>", None);
test_tag_completion(r#"<div class="">|"#, Some("$0</div>".to_string()));
test_tag_completion("<img>|", None);
test_tag_completion("<div><br></|", Some("div>".to_string()));
test_tag_completion("<div><br><span></span></|", Some("div>".to_string()));
test_tag_completion(
"<div><h1><br><span></span><img></| </h1></div>",
Some("h1>".to_string()),
);
test_tag_completion(
"<ng-template><td><ng-template></| </td> </ng-template>",
Some("ng-template>".to_string()),
);
test_tag_completion("<div><br></|>", Some("div".to_string()));
}
